BioVader 04-04-2006 07:41 PM

Like this? I've tried putting it right after Membership App and get errors.. This way errors out too..

PHP Code:

$formtitle "Membership Application";

////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
//TITLE OF THREAD/POST/PM/EMAIL (do not use quotation marks in the title or you will get a parse error)
//You may use variables from the form for this.
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////

$posttitle "$formtitle $bbuserinfo['username']"

Error:
Parse error: parse error, unexpected T_ENCAPSED_AND_WHITESPACE, expecting T_STRING or T_VARIABLE or T_NUM_STRING in /home/xxx/public_html/forums/newthread.php(68) : eval()'d code on line 151

Abe1 04-04-2006 08:19 PM

Quote:

Originally Posted by BioVader
Like this? I've tried putting it right after Membership App and get errors.. This way errors out too..

PHP Code:

$formtitle "Membership Application";

////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
//TITLE OF THREAD/POST/PM/EMAIL (do not use quotation marks in the title or you will get a parse error)
//You may use variables from the form for this.
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////

$posttitle "$formtitle $bbuserinfo['username']"

Error:
Parse error: parse error, unexpected T_ENCAPSED_AND_WHITESPACE, expecting T_STRING or T_VARIABLE or T_NUM_STRING in /home/xxx/public_html/forums/newthread.php(68) : eval()'d code on line 151

Make it $bbuserinfo[username] since you have it in quote.
